Overview

The Historic Adams House is a beautifully preserved example of Queen Anne Victorian architecture, offering a glimpse into the opulent lifestyle of the late 19th century. The house was built in 1892 for Deadwood pioneers Harris and Anna Franklin Adams and is now a museum filled with original artifacts and furnishings.

The house is significant for its well-preserved architecture and its connection to the colorful history of Deadwood during the Black Hills Gold Rush.
